NSTP Extends DEFTECH Incubation Program Application Deadline To September 10

Published on

National Science and Technology Park has extended the application deadline for its DEFTECH Incubation Program to 10 September 2026, giving startups and individuals working on defence and dual use technology ideas additional time to apply. The programme falls under NSTP’s broader sectoral incubation structure at NUST, which has historically organized support across categories including AgriTech, AutoTech, EdTech, EnergyTech, FinTech, HealthTech, SmartTech, and DefTech.

DefTech at NSTP focuses on areas including aerospace, drones, radar systems, cyber warfare, military wearables, and specialized imaging and surveillance equipment, drawing on NUST’s existing research base and infrastructure. The programme has previously supported the development of technologies such as ground surveillance radar and unmanned aerial vehicle systems, positioning it as a specialized track distinct from the broader consumer or enterprise focused incubation programmes more common across Pakistan’s startup ecosystem.

The extended deadline gives applicants an additional window to prepare submissions for a category of startup that typically requires longer development cycles and more specialized technical review than commercial technology ventures. The programme is supported by The AKD Group, UK, reflecting continued private sector interest in Pakistan’s defence and dual use technology development. DEFTECH forms part of NSTP’s wider incubation portfolio at NUST, which has produced more than 150 graduated startups and drawn significant investor interest across its various sector specific tracks since its establishment.
